Job Description

Overview

We are seeking an experienced Android Developer with strong Kotlin expertise and a deep understanding of modern mobile development practices. The ideal candidate will be highly collaborative, proactive, and committed to delivering high-quality, maintainable solutions. Only candidates eligible for BPSS clearance will be considered.

Required Skills & Experience

  • Eligibility for BPSS clearance.
  • 5+ years of hands-on Android development experience using Kotlin and Android Studio.
  • Strong understanding of Android design principlesUI/UX guidelines, and best practices.
  • Passion for mobile development with a commitment to staying current with the latest Android trends and technologies.
  • Solid understanding of MVVM architecture and associated design patterns.
  • Ability to apply SOLID principles to ensure clean, scalable, and maintainable code.
  • A strong DevOps mindset, understanding how software interacts with infrastructure.
  • Good understanding of CI/CD processes and practical experience implementing pipelines.
  • Strong problem-solving skills with a proactive approach to identifying and resolving issues.
  • Excellent collaboration skills and the desire to work closely with cross-functional teams.

Nice-to-Have Skills

  • Understanding of the Android compilation process and how code is converted into an executable.
  • Knowledge or experience working with FHIR standards.
  • Understanding of effective memory management, including garbage collection and reference handling.
